Job Description

Description

The Grocery operations team is seeking an experienced and innovative Business Analyst to help shape the future of grocery shrink and waste optimization.

You will support the rapid growth of this initiative by developing business metrics, mining data to uncover consumer insights and business opportunity, establishing new reporting and partnering with internal stakeholders to drive the business. The ideal candidate will be highly analytical with proven experience delivering results.

Specific responsibilities include identifying the necessary metrics and creating reports to increase understanding of the business, proactively identifying pain points or opportunities through systemic measurement. The Business Analyst will be detail oriented, and possess expertise in both qualitative and quantitative analysis with a passion for delivering actionable insights to key stakeholders. The right candidate will blend advanced reporting with strong critical thinking and project management skills. Your success in the role will have a large impact on improving the customer experience and growing the business.

The successful candidate will communicate effectively across teams and levels, while balancing the needs and requirements of internal and external customers. They will be relentlessly focused on improving the customer experience. Flexibility and the ability to prioritize in a changing business environment will also be key. Our team culture is goal-oriented, collaborative and driven to achieve results. We seek an individual who is motivated by a fast-paced and highly entrepreneurial environment.

A day in the life

Partner across stakeholders to identify and build new weekly and daily reporting to provide insights into shrink management and optimization. Establish new dashboards and analytics to proactively manage grocery and perishable efficiency.

Basic Qualifications

  • 3+ years of tax, finance or a related analytical field experience
  • 5+ years of Excel (including VBA, pivot tables, array functions, power pivots, etc.) and data visualization tools such as Tableau experience
  • 3+ years of business or financial analysis experience
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ent
  • Experience defining requirements and using data and metrics to draw business insights
  • Experience with Excel
  • Experience with SQL
  • Experience making business recommendations and influencing stakeholders

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ience in Excel (including VBA, pivot tables, array functions, power pivots, etc.) and data visualization tools such as Tableau

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several US geographic markets. The base pay for this position ranges from $66,900/year in our lowest geographic market up to $143,100/year in our highest geographic market. Pay is based on a number of factors including market location and may vary depending on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. Amazon is a total compensation company. Dependent on the position offered, equity, sign-on payments, and other forms of compensation may be provided as part of a total compensation package, in addition to a full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its.
